Stevie Wonder

Mentioned in 46 analyzed podcast episodes across 10 shows

A legendary soul and R&B musician widely cited across podcasts as a major influence on contemporary artists' songwriting, composition, and musicianship approaches. Frequently referenced as a cultural touchstone for musical excellence and emotional authenticity, with his work spanning songwriting, keyboard performance, and live performance at major events. Podcasters discuss him both as a foundational influence on the R&B genre and for his broader cultural significance, including references to his blindness and his contributions to music across multiple decades.
